Course contents

Architecture 41 New Building components - doors, windows, partitions, stairs, ironmongery uses and detailing, materials, fixing, installation and handling. Factors affecting choices of building components. Design and fabrication of components; joinery detailing. Panelling, windows, doors and their functional requirements.
